Single-molecule techniques now permit the tracking of a transcription complex along a DNA template in real time and to 1 bp resolution. As reported in this issue of Cell, Herbert et al. (2006) exploit this approach to study a central component of transcription regulation, the sequence-dependent pausing of RNA polymerase during transcript elongation.
